W for me was one of the best Kamen Riders in years. It had a good cast of characters with interesting villains and monsters.

Shoutarou, the man was just half a man until he became a full man but was still really half a man in the end. Philip, a dead person with no memories of his past who was sheltered in the beginning but slowly became more confident in himself and learn to love the city of Fuuto and its people especially Shoutarou. Akiko, an annoying girl who hits people with slippers when doing something that she disagrees with to a caring and mature woman who still hits people with slippers. Terui, a cop who was obsess with revenge for his family who eventually learn compassion towards the enemy and not get caught in revenge.

The Sonozaki family may seem an evil and selfish family but they were really fractured for a very long time ever since Philip died the first time. Ryuubee gave up on his family and focus on the Gaia Impact which had profound effects on the surviving members. Shroud didn't like the way Ryuubee was using Philip and eventually ended up covering up her face. She decides to take revenge on Ryuubee in order to save Philip but she was lost along the way and didn't care about the lives lost towards her goal. She realized that she lost a part of her humanity and was forgiven by Terui and Philip. She got her wish in the end when Shoutarou was able to give Philip a smile in the very end.

Saeko was the oldest sister who really had nothing but her pride to beat out Wakana. Some people may say that Saeko became less interesting when she has father issues but so what. It makes her a real person instead of some crazy woman who wants to take over the world. Her men throughout the series showed how much control Saeko was losing. With Kirihiko, she had all the control. With Isaka, she gave up some of that control. Finally with Kazu, she had none. Her death was sad that she got nothing in very end and even ended up saving the sister she hated for all her life.

Wakana was shown in the beginning as a two-faced person. She was the Healing Princess in the public but in private, she was a snob. She wasn't interested in the family business or wanted to be a part of it. Her growing relationship with Philip made her want to leave the family for good but she ended up running the family business in the end. She couldn't stand the screams of the Earth which made her able to do terrible things. Regardless of what she was going to do, she was forgiven by Philip which in return, she gave up her life to restore Philip. With that act, she became the Healing Princess.

In the end, W is really about the bond between Shoutarou and Philip and how it grows throughout the series. It was truly enjoyable from start to end. If I rank Heisei KR series, there would be a tie between Blade and W. They are 1 and 1a. Looks like OOO has some work to do but I shouldn't be saying that since it's not fair to OOO at all.

I went into this massivly hyped up. Who knows why? Perhaps it was the bad taste Decade was leaving in my mouth. I still have that first 1 minute long promo in my folder with my W eps, just because it was that good. The problem was, I didn't really get into W until about episode 6, when there was that epic sea battle against the giant Anomalocaris and LunaTrigger W kicks the crap out of him. Then I thought back, Giant Bike chase in episode 2, fight on the top of a moving bus on episode 3, this series was pulling out all the stops.

To be honest, I think W was the kick in the pants that the hesei rider series needed. It shows what can be accomplished plot wise with a) A small, core set of developed chatacters and b) what happens when you develop the villains from the start of the series rather than towards the middle/end which had been the case in the past. It also shows that you don't need as many main riders as a sentai team, with just two in this case being ample.

I'm really going to miss W, more so than any other series that has ended to date.
